Otis Worldwide: A Resilient Investment with Significant Upside Potential

Otis Worldwide Corporation stands out as a compelling investment choice, exhibiting remarkable resilience in the face of economic headwinds such as tariffs and inflationary pressures. Despite a recent dip in performance, primarily due to squeezed margins in its New Equipment division and a significant sales reduction in the Chinese market, the company is well-positioned for future growth. Its solid financial health, coupled with strategic share repurchases and effective cost-management strategies by its leadership, ensures the stability of its earnings and the security of its dividends. This in-depth analysis forecasts a substantial appreciation in Otis's stock value over the coming two to three years, driven by an easing of margin constraints and an anticipated surge in the elevator market, projecting a discounted cash flow (DCF) based target of $115.

The current underperformance of Otis's stock can be directly attributed to pressures within its New Equipment sector. A notable factor is the approximately 20% drop in sales volume experienced in the Chinese market, alongside the lingering effects of tariffs. These challenges have collectively contributed to a reduction in profit margins, leading to investor caution. However, it is crucial to recognize these as transient issues rather than fundamental flaws in the company's long-term viability.

Management's proactive approach to these challenges is a key indicator of future success. Through diligent cost-saving measures and an ongoing commitment to share buybacks, Otis is not only mitigating immediate risks but also enhancing shareholder value. These actions, combined with a robust balance sheet, underscore the company's financial discipline and its capacity to weather economic storms while safeguarding its dividend payouts.
